DIFFERENCE BETWEEN SPERMATOGENESIS AND OOGENESIS -

It take place in testis
It take place whole life
In maturation phase many series of spermatogonia & residual spermatogonia are formed
Growth phase take place short period
Less growth during growth phase
No any division in growth phase
In growth phase primary spermatocyte formed
During maturation phase 4 spermatid formed
In this meiosis first then differentiation
sperms are motile
in ovary
45 to 50 years
Oogonia, accessory nurse cell & follicle cells are formed
long period
More growth during growth phsae
Meiosis start in growth phase up to diplotene stage
Primary oocyte formed
1 ovum and 3 polar bodies are formed
In this differentiation first then meiosis
Ova is immotile.
